Output e95b88a4b51a04f94a6bd96e9b58313bed228ef56107dff7e3cf12126fa847ab:0

value
143234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ac224adf5f7ab16894fc49c090774e1f982f171 OP_EQUAL
address
32fuFmpdbmnkt5Xr2imFSG43BFgTTXrNG9
transaction
e95b88a4b51a04f94a6bd96e9b58313bed228ef56107dff7e3cf12126fa847ab
confirmations
324016
spent
true